This tutorial demonstrates how to calculate the arc length of a function using a TI-89 graphing calculator. It covers three methods: using the home screen, the graphing screen, and the arc length formula. Each method is explained step-by-step, including how to input the function and adjust settings for accurate results. The tutorial provides both exact and approximate values for the arc length over a specified interval.
